Big Mac Wrap

A quick and delicious wrap inspired by the iconic Big Mac, filled with savory ground beef, fresh toppings, and a creamy homemade sauce, perfect for a nostalgic and satisfying weeknight dinner.

Ingredients

For the Wraps

  • 1 lb ground beef
  • Salt & pepper to taste
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 4 large flour tortillas (burrito-size)
  • 1 cup shredded lettuce
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• ½ cup diced pickles
  • ½ small red onion, finely chopped (optional)

For the 'Big Mac' Sauce

  • ½ cup mayo
  • 2 tbsp ketchup
  • 1 tbsp yellow mustard
  • 1 tbsp sweet relish
  • 1 tsp white vinegar
  • ½ tsp garlic powder
  • ½ tsp onion powder
  • Salt to taste

Instructions

Preparation

  • In a skillet over medium heat, brown ground beef with gar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per.
  • Break it into crumbles and cook until fully browned. Drain any excess grease.
  • Meanwhile, in a bowl, mix together all sauce ingredients until smooth. Adjust to taste; refrigerate while assembling wraps.
  • Warm tortillas slightly to make them pliable.

Assembly

  • Spread a spoonful of sauce on each tortilla.
  • Add cooked beef, shredded lettuce, cheese, pickles, and onion, layering them beautifully.
  • Drizzle more sauce on top.
  • Fold into a burrito-style wrap.
  • Optionally, toast seam-side down in a dry skillet for 1–2 minutes per side until golden.

Notes

For a healthier version, consider using lean turkey or chicken, whole grain tortillas, or Greek yogurt in the sauce. Store unassembled wraps in the freezer for up to 3 months.
